Earrings are attached to the ear through a hole in the earlobe or any other part of the outer ear, except in the case of clip earring, which clips on earlobe. Other sites of piercing the ear lobe includes top, tragus, or in a spiral. Usually the term “piercing” usually refers to the lobe hole, while hole in the upper part of the external ear are often referred to as “cartilage hole.” Cartilage piercings are more complex than lead piercing earlobe and it takes longer to heal.
Can be pierced components made from any number of materials including metals, plastics, glass and precious stones and beads. Designs can range from small loops and studs to large plates or hanging items. Size is usually limited by the physical capacity of the earlobe to hold the earring without tearing. People who used to wear heavy earrings may find that over time, the earlobe and piercing stretch.
